Philippsreut Sunshine Hours by Month
Sunshine plays a big role in understanding the climate of a city. This page shows the total number of hours of direct sunlight per month and the average hours per day in Philippsreut, Bavaria, Germany. These values are calculated using 30 years of data (1990–2020) to ensure accuracy.
Monthly hours of sunshine
Sunshine in Philippsreut varies greatly throughout the year. The sunniest month, July, reaches an impressive 230 hours, while December, the darkest month, offers only 41 hours. The total annual amount of sun is 1693 hours.
Daily hours of sunshine
For those who appreciate different seasons, Philippsreut serves as an ideal destination. Expect longer, more sun-filled days in July with an average of 7.7 hours of sunshine daily, and embrace the darker days in December, offering only 1.4 hours of daily sunlight.

Related Climate Data for Philippsreut
July, Philippsreut’s wettest month, receives 134 mm (5.3 in) of rainfall and has a maximum daytime temperature of 23°C (73°F). During the driest month November you can expect a temperature of 6°C (43°F).
